Easy Garlic Shrimp Pasta

  • Author: Ava Garrison
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 15 minutes
  • Total Time: 30 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ings
  • Category: Dinner
  • Method: Stovetop
  • Cuisine: Italian

Ingredients

12 oz spaghetti or linguine

1 lb large shrimp, peeled and deveined

6 cloves garlic, minced

3 tbsp olive oil

1/2 tsp red pepper flakes (adjust to taste)

1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ped

1 lemon, zested and juiced

1/3 cup grated Parmesan cheese

Salt and pepper to taste


Instructions

1.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Cook the pasta until al dente according to the package instructions. Reserve 1 cup of pasta water, then drain and set aside.

2. In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add minced garlic and sauté for 30 seconds to 1 minute until fragrant.

3. Add the shrimp in a single layer. Season with salt, pepper, and red pepper flakes. Cook 1-2 minutes per side until pink and cooked through. Remove shrimp and set aside.

4. Add the cooked pasta to the skillet with garlic oil. Toss to coat and splash in reserved pasta water to loosen if needed. Stir in lemon zest and juice.

5. Return shrimp to the skillet and combine everything. Add parsley and Parmesan. Toss gently.

6. Serve immediately with extra Parmesan, lemon wedges, and a sprinkle of chili flakes if desired.


Notes

Always dry the shrimp before cooking to get a good sear.

Don’t skip the reserved pasta water—it creates the perfect light sauce.

Fresh lemon juice at the end really lifts the whole dish.
